Bulgarian Prosecution Accused of Covering Up Corruption Amid Euro-Prosecutor's Testimony Offer
Bulgaria's state prosecution is accused of covering up corruption, two days after Euro-prosecutor Teodora Georgieva offered to testify about connections between a disappeared influence broker in the judicial system and former investigator Petyo Petrov, Borislav Sarafov, and Delyan Peevski.
